It’s hard to think of a more self-explanatory feature than Circle to Search: it does exactly what it sounds like. You circle something on your phone screen, tap a button and that’s it! A page full of Google search results telling you what you’ve circled. Easy, right? The new feature it’s launching on five phones to start – the three members of Samsung’s new Galaxy S24 series, as well as Google’s Pixel 8 and 8 Pro – before arriving at other “select and premium” Android phones.

Well, maybe it is he does I need a little explanation. If the feature sounds familiar, you might be thinking of Google Lens, which is similar. But instead of opening the Google app, you can use Circle to search anywhere on your device. Just press and hold the home button if you’re using three-button navigation – or the navigation handle if you’re using gesture navigation – and it will appear at the top of whatever app or screen you’re currently using. You can circle, highlight, or tap a subject, including text and images.
